As part of the partnership, both companies will expand their existing partnership to offer end-to-end marketing technology services to customers, Wipro said in a statement.
Founded in 1923, NYSE-listed Harte Hanks is a global marketing services company specialising in omni-channel marketing solutions including consulting, strategic assessment, data, analytics, digital, social, mobile, print, direct mail and contact centre.
Harte Hanks has over 5,000 employees in North America, Asia-Pacific and Europe. Its revenue stood at USD 404.4 million in 2016.
The investment is expected to be completed during the quarter ending March 31, 2018, subject to customary closing conditions, Wipro said in a BSE filing.
"By bundling marketing and technology solutions in the value proposition, Harte Hanks and Wipro offer an integrated solution, which addresses needs of chief marketing and digital officers in a holistic manner," the filing said.
This investment strengthens our existing partnership with Harte Hanks and enables us to address a key industry challenge by offering 'Marketing as a Service', Wipro President Consumer Business Unit Srini Pallia said.
